Programmable Logic Controller (PLC) Programming Fundamentals

Mastering control system design requires a firm grasp of fundamental concepts. PLCs, or Programmable Logic Controllers, are the backbone of modern industrial automation, enabling precise control of diverse processes. To become proficient in PLC programming, you'll need to become acquainted with ladder logic diagrams, components, and the specific software used by your chosen PLC platform. Understanding how to configure PLCs for various applications, including feedback systems, is crucial for success in this field.

  • Hone strong analytical and problem-solving skills.
  • Comprehend electrical schematics and industrial processes.
  • Leverage simulation tools to test and debug PLC programs.
